If you have ever dabbled on the planet of SEO or electronic promoting, you've almost certainly heard of backlinks. They are the lifeblood of online search engine rankings, the golden ticket which can help your web site soar to the very best of Google’s search engine results. Although not https://franko120edb6.idblogz.com/profile